2. Compact proportions and strong visual presence

In everyday life, a square table is often a smart choice because it makes good use of the space: compact, yet with a strong visual presence. And at Konte.Design, the variety is real: you will find, for example, 80×80 cm and 90×90 cm fixed versions, but also book-opening models that go from 80×80 to 160×80, from 90×90 to 180×90, and from 100×100 up to 200×100.

To keep it practical without becoming “too technical”, you can read the sizes like this:

  • 80×80 and 90×90: perfect for everyday use and more compact spaces
  • Book-opening up to 160/180/200 cm: when you want to turn a square table into a longer dining table, without changing your overall furnishing setup

2. Finishes, colors and combinations

Here are the most representative finishes you will come across in this category:

Warm and contemporary woods
Oak and walnut are timeless classics for warming up a room: in Konte.Design proposals, you will also find them in bolder versions, such as rustic oak or walnut, perfect with fabric or metal chairs.

Light, bright, easy to match
If you love airy interiors, you can opt for finishes such as white ash, pearl elm, antique white or white lacquered tables: solutions that lighten the overall look and work beautifully in both kitchens and dining rooms.

Urban and industrial material effects
For a more metropolitan look, you will find surfaces such as concrete gray and bolder interpretations such as oxide-effect ceramic, often paired with painted metal structures (anthracite or white, depending on the final effect you want to achieve).

Marble effect, for a more premium look
If you want a table that instantly elevates the tone of the room, there are finishes such as Statuario marble or marble-effect variants: the result is more elegant, yet still easy to incorporate when paired with coherent chairs and lighting.
